> Honestly, I wish both the Performer and OpenGL Optimizer FAQs would
> have a discussion about which is more appropriate for a given app.
> I'm much more inclined to use OpenGL Optimizer for walkthrus, but
> since OGLO is so new, I don't see as much model support as I do for
> Performer (I can only determine there's a loader for Wavefront/Alias
> .obj format and the .iv format, any others?).
Optimizer has loaders for pfb, csb and iv. You could
always write one for obj :)
>
> There doesn't seem to be much "Cross-feed" between the Performer and
> OGLO camps other than "Yeah, we know about that other group".
Actually they talk a lot and are in the same hallway.
I spent part of my summer writeing a csb loader for
Performer, so you could use Optimizer to create models to
be loaded into Perfomer. It should be out w/ Perf 2.2
